Package: linux-sound-base
Version: 1.0.11-2

When upgrading linux-sound-base, I get the following error, and the
package fails to configure:

        ln: creating symbolic link `/etc/modprobe.d/linux-sound-base_noOSS' to 
`/lib/linux-sound-base/noOSS.modprobe.conf': No such file or directory

Even though this machine does run a 2.6 kernel, it's an embedded machine
which doesn't use kernel modules, so it didn't have module-init-tools
installed, which means that it didn't have an /etc/modprobe.d directory.
